Understanding Quad Mazes
Quad Mazes are a type of puzzle where the player must navigate through a grid divided into four quadrants. Each quadrant has its own maze, and the goal is to find a path from the start to the finish without crossing any lines. This format not only challenges the mind but also provides a fun and interactive experience for children.

Specifications for Your KDP Quad Maze Book
To ensure your maze book is ready for publication, follow these specifications:
- Dimensions: 8.5 x 11 inches (standard letter size).
- File Formats: PDF and PNG files for both the puzzles and solutions.
- Bleed: Include a 0.125-inch bleed on all sides to ensure there are no white borders after printing.
- Puzzle Layout: 50 quad mazes, one per page, with corresponding solutions on separate pages.
- Total Pages: 100 pages (50 pages of puzzles + 50 pages of solutions).

Creating High-Quality Quad Mazes
Here are some tips to help you create high-quality and engaging quad mazes:
- Start Simple: Begin with easier mazes and gradually increase the difficulty level.
- Vary Designs: Use different shapes and patterns to keep the puzzles interesting.
- Test Thoroughly: Solve each maze yourself to ensure it is solvable and enjoyable.
- Include Instructions: Provide clear and concise instructions on how to solve the mazes.
Formatting and Testing Your Maze Book
Proper formatting and testing are crucial for a professional and error-free publication. Hereβs how to do it:
- Use Professional Tools: Utilize design software like Adobe Illustrator or Inkscape to create clean and precise mazes.
- Consistent Layout: Maintain a consistent layout throughout the book, including margins, font sizes, and puzzle placement.
- Print Test: Print a few sample pages to check for any issues with alignment, clarity, and overall appearance.
- Proofread: Carefully proofread the entire book to catch and correct any errors.
Uploading Your Maze Book to KDP
Once your maze book is ready, follow these steps to upload it to KDP:
- Create a KDP Account: If you don't already have one, sign up for a KDP account.
- Prepare Your Files: Have your PDF and PNG files ready, along with a cover image and book description.
- Upload Your Files: Log in to your KDP account and use the "Create a New Title" feature to upload your files.
- Add Metadata: Fill in the required metadata, including title, author name, keywords, and categories.
- Set Pricing and Royalties: Choose a price for your book and set your royalty preferences.
- Publish: Review all details and click "Publish" to make your book live on Amazon.
